Hotel is very close to a lot of seaside facilities - eating places, amusement arcades, the Big Wheel, etc. It is around 15 minutes walk to the town centre with a good range of shops and around 8 minutes to an attractive park. It does not have its own car park but there was always space available on the road outside. It is a good value very old low price hotel with almost no amenities beyond the bedrooms. No lifts, so need to be able to get bags up and down stairs. Hopeless for wheelchair users - there are also steps at entrance. Staff are largely invisible, but room and bathroom were always clean and well kept.
